Role Summary

Verify CPU/SoC microarchitecture and system-level features across simulators, FPGA, and silicon. Work on verification environments spanning unit, subsystem, and full-chip testbenches and partner closely with architects and cross-functional teams.

Focus is on developing and executing robust verification plans and driving issues to resolution across software simulator and silicon bring-up stages.

Responsibilities

Primary responsibilities for this role include:

  • Develop, maintain, and run verification environments for unit, subsystem, and full-chip levels, including FPGA and silicon bring-up.
  • Verify micro-architecture and architectural features, and implement coverage-driven tests.
  • Collaborate with CPU architects to produce verifiable designs and close verification gaps.
  • Create and validate end-to-end sequences on software simulators and on silicon with full software stacks.
  • Debug failures across simulation and silicon and drive root-cause analysis and fixes.
  • Coordinate with geographically distributed, multi-functional teams to integrate verification results and requirements.
